Stop harassing people on name of smart meters: Hari Singh, Uday
8/10/2023 10:37:19 PM
Early Times Report

JAMMU, Aug 10: Hari Singh Chib, President of District Congress Committee Jammu Rural, has raised serious concerns about the harassment being faced by the people of Jammu region with regard to the installation of Smart Meters.
Chib highlighted these concerns during a door-to-door campaign conducted with Uday Bhanu Chib, Senior Leader of Indian Youth Congress, in the Jammu North Assembly segment.
During the campaign, both the senior Congress leaders personally addressed the issues faced by the people and listened to their grievances. Hari Singh Chib observed that a major portion of the population is dissatisfied with the implementation of Smart Meters, as they have become a source of harassment for electricity consumers.
The DDC Rural President said that the electricity supply system in Jammu region is in complete disarray, and the installation of Smart Meters has only worsened the situation. He expressed his disappointment in the Power Department for leaving the people of Jammu region with no other option than to endure overcharged electricity bills and constant unscheduled power cuts. He asserted that the exorbitant electricity charges are beyond the means of the general masses, and the electricity bills are excessively inflated.
Uday Chib said that people are receiving electricity bills in thousands and even lakhs, indicating a new norm of charging consumers for electricity they have not used. He demanded a thorough investigation into the ongoing cheating and harassment of electricity consumers. He urged the concerned authorities to take action against those responsible for wrong bills and provide relief to the general masses.
He said government is purchasing power at an average rate of Rs 3.75 per unit then why bills in thousands are coming from houses of poor people.
Uday Chib highlighted the increased frequency of unscheduled power cuts, which have caused significant problems for the people, particularly the elderly, the ailing, and children.
